Mixed media reality recognition using multiple specialized indexes
US-9495385-B2 · Nov 15, 2016 · US
US10007928B2 · US · B2
| Field | Value |
|---|---|
| Publication number | US-10007928-B2 |
| Application number | US-201514804241-A |
| Country | US |
| Kind code | B2 |
| Filing date | Jul 20, 2015 |
| Priority date | Oct 1, 2004 |
| Publication date | Jun 26, 2018 |
| Grant date | Jun 26, 2018 |
A practical reading order for non-experts. Skip the full description unless you need deep technical detail.
What the patent document calls the invention.
A short plain-language summary of the technical disclosure.
Who owns or filed the patent and who is credited as inventor.
Filing, priority, publication, and grant dates set the timeline.
The legal scope of protection — read this for what is actually claimed.
Technology tags used to group this patent with similar filings.
Prior art links and similar publications in this corpus.
Official abstract text for this publication.
A context-aware targeted information delivery system comprises a mobile device, an MMR matching unit, a plurality of databases for user profiles, user context and advertising information, a plurality of comparison engines and a plurality of weight adjusters. The mobile device is coupled to deliver an image patch to the MMR matching unit which in turn performs recognition to produce recognize text. The recognized text is provided to a first and second comparison engines to produce relevant topics and relevant ads. The relevant topics and relevant ads are adjusted with information from a user context database including information such as location, date, time, and other information from a user profile. The third comparison engine compares the relevant topics and relevant ads to produce a set of final ads that are most related to the topics of interest for the user and delivered for display on to the mobile device.
Opening claim text (preview).
What is claimed is: 1. A computer-implemented method comprising: receiving an input image from a camera of a mobile device; performing, with one or more processors, a visual search within a database of mixed media objects using the input image to identify and retrieve a mixed media object corresponding to the input image; producing recognized text for a portion of the retrieved mixed media object corresponding to the input image and a document context including text surrounding the input image, each word of the recognized text having a word relevancy weight; creating a user context based on user interaction data over time to identify user trends; receiving targeted information; generating, with the one or more processors, relevant targeted information based on the word relevancy weight of each word of the recognized text, the document context including the text surrounding the input image, the user context, and the targeted information; and providing the relevant targeted information to the user, wherein the relevant targeted information includes an element that allows the user to perform an action. 2. The computer-implemented method of claim 1 , wherein receiving the targeted information comprises searching for the targeted information based on a location of the mobile device. 3. The computer-implemented method of claim 1 , wherein the targeted information includes an advertisement, the advertisement having a hyperlink selectable by the user to perform the action. 4. The computer-implemented method of claim 1 , wherein providing the relevant targeted information to the user comprises transmitting the relevant targeted information for presentation on the mobile device. 5. The computer-implemented method of claim 1 , wherein the document context further includes at least one from a group of: text appearing in the input image; previous targets a user hovered over; and hotspots surrounding the input image. 6. The computer-implemented method of claim 1 , further comprising: determining the word relevancy weight for each word of the recognized text. 7. The computer-implemented method of claim 6 , wherein the word relevancy weight is based on a distance from the center of the input image. 8. A system comprising: one or more processors; and a memory storing instructions, which when executed, cause the one or more processors to: receive an input image from a camera of a mobile device; perform a visual search within a database of mixed media objects using the input image to identify and retrieve a mixed media object corresponding to the input image; produce recognized text for a portion of the retrieved mixed media object corresponding to the input image and a document context including text surrounding the input image, each word of the recognized text having a word relevancy weight; create a user context based on user interaction data over time to identify user trends; receive targeted information; generate relevant targeted information based on the word relevancy weight of each word of the recognized text, the document context including the text surrounding the input image, the user context, and the targeted information; and provide the relevant targeted information to the user, wherein the relevant targeted information includes an element that allows the user to perform an action. 9. The system of claim 8 , wherein to receive the targeted information, the instructions cause the one or more processors to search for the targeted information based on a location of the mobile device. 10. The system of claim 8 , wherein the targeted information includes an advertisement, the advertisement having a hyperlink selectable by the user to perform the action. 11. The system of claim 8 , wherein to provide the relevant targeted information to the user, the instructions cause the one or more processors to transmit the relevant targeted information for presentation on the mobile device. 12. The system of claim 8 , wherein the document context further includes at least one from a group of: text appearing in the input image; previous targets a user hovered over; and hotspots surrounding the input image. 13. The system of claim 8 , wherein the instructions cause the one or more processors to determine the word relevancy weight for each word of the recognized text. 14. The system of claim 13 , wherein the word relevancy weight is based on a distance from the center of the input image. 15. A computer program product comprising a non-transitory computer useable medium including a computer readable program, wherein the computer readable program when executed on a computer causes the computer to: receive an input image from a camera of a mobile device; perform a visual search within a database of mixed media objects using the input image to identify and retrieve a mixed media object corresponding to the input image; produce recognized text for a portion of the retrieved mixed media object corresponding to the input image and a document context including text surrounding the input image, each word of the recognized text having a word relevancy weight; create a user context based on user interaction data over time to identify user trends; receive targeted information; generate relevant targeted information based on the word relevancy weight of each word of the recognized text, the document context including the text surrounding the input image, the user context, and the targeted information; and provide the relevant targeted information to the user, wherein the relevant targeted information includes an element that allows the user to perform an action. 16. The computer program product of claim 15 , wherein the targeted information includes an advertisement, the advertisement having a hyperlink selectable by the user to perform the action. 17. The computer program product of claim 15 , wherein to provide the relevant targeted information to the user, the computer readable program causes the computer to transmit the relevant targeted information for presentation on the mobile device. 18. The computer program product of claim 15 , wherein the document context further includes at least one from a group of: text appearing in the input image; previous targets a user hovered over; and hotspots surrounding the input image. 19. The computer program product of claim 15 , wherein the computer readable program causes the computer to determine the word relevancy weight for each word of the recognized text. 20. The computer program product of claim 19 , wherein the word relevancy weight is based on a distance from the center of the input image.
of multimedia data, e.g. slideshows comprising image and additional audio data (retrieval of still image data G06F16/50; retrieval of audio data G06F16/60; retrieval of video data G06F16/70) · CPC title
Fusion techniques, i.e. combining data from various sources, e.g. sensor fusion · CPC title
Validation; Performance evaluation · CPC title
Selection of pattern recognition techniques, e.g. of classifiers in a multi-classifier system · CPC title
of classification results, e.g. of results related to same input data · CPC title
Related publications grouped by family.
Answers are generated from the same data shown on this page.